{ "info": { "author": "Francesco Filicetti", "author_email": "francesco.filicetti@unical.it", "bugtrack_url": null, "classifiers": [ "Environment :: Web Environment", "Framework :: Django", "Framework :: Django :: 2.1", "Intended Audience :: Developers", "License :: OSI Approved :: BSD License", "Operating System :: OS Independent", "Programming Language :: Python", "Programming Language :: Python :: 3", "Topic :: Internet :: WWW/HTTP", "Topic :: Internet :: WWW/HTTP :: Dynamic Content" ], "description": "Template Django conforme a linee guida AGID per l'Universit\u00e0 della Calabria\n---------------------------------------------------------------------------\n\nTemplate grafico per il framework Python Django, per applicazioni\ndell'Univerist\u00e0 della Calabria, basato sulla libreria Bootstrap Italia\ndell'Agenzia per l'Italia Digitale (AGID).\n\nL'app estende [django-bootstrap-italia](https://github.com/francesco-filicetti/django-bootstrap-italia).\n\n![Home](data/gallery/default.png)\n_**Frontend**: Schermata di default del template_\n\n\nRequirements\n------------\n\n```\ndjango-bootstrap-italia\nlibsass\ndjango-compressor\ndjango-sass-processor\n```\n\n#### django-sass-processor\n\nCompilazione di SASS 3 (file .scss) per Django.\n\nhttps://pypi.org/project/django-sass-processor/\n\n\nInstallazione\n-------------\n\n```\npip install django-unical-agid-template\n```\n- In settings.py INSTALLED_APPS inserire *unical_agid_template*.\n\n\nUtilizzo\n--------\n\n```\npython manage.py collectstatic\n```\n\n- Configurare il file ```base-setup.html``` eseguendo l'overload dei blocchi\nprincipali, al fine di personalizzare le sezioni di interesse;\n- Ogni pagina HTML del proprio progetto dovr\u00e0 estendere ```base-setup.html```\ne definire il contenuto del blocco ```{% container %}```. Header e Footer\nsaranno sempre ereditati da ```base-setup.html```, a meno di variazioni su\nsingole pagine.\n\n\nStile e CSS/SCSS\n----------------\n\nPer la personalizzazione dello stile del template (colori, dimensioni, sfondi)\nsi utilizza SASS 3 (Syntactically Awesome Style Sheets), in modo\nda rispettare le caratteristiche responsive ereditate.\n\nIl foglio di stile che ridefinisce l'aspetto del tema di default \u00e8\n```static/css/unical-style.scss```.\n\nE' sempre possibile integrare fogli di stile o javascript\neffettuando l'overload del blocco ```{% extra_head %}```.\n\n\n\nEsempio di base-setup.html\n--------------------\n\n```\n\n{% extends 'bootstrap-italia-base.html' %}\n\n\n{% load sass_tags %}\n\n{% load static %}\n\n\n{% block page_title %}\nUniversit\u00e0 della Calabria\n{% endblock page_title %}\n\n\n{% block extra_head %}\n\n{% endblock extra_head %}\n\n\n{% block header_slim_org_url %}\nhttps://www.unical.it\n{% endblock header_slim_org_url %}\n\n\n{% block header_slim_org_name %}\nUniversit\u00e0 della Calabria\n{% endblock header_slim_org_name %}\n\n\n{% block header_slim_mobile_org_name %}\nUniversit\u00e0 della Calabria\n{% endblock header_slim_mobile_org_name %}\n\n\n{% block header_mobile_arrow %}{% endblock header_mobile_arrow %}\n{% block header_mobile_slim_menu %}{% endblock header_mobile_slim_menu %}\n\n\n{% block header_center_logo %}\n\n{% endblock header_center_logo %}\n\n\n{% block header_center_org_name %}\nUniversit\u00e0 della Calabria\n{% endblock header_center_org_name %}\n\n\n{% block header_center_org_subname %}\nIl Campus per eccellenza\n{% endblock header_center_org_subname %}\n\n\n{% block footer_logo %}\n\n{% endblock footer_logo %}\n\n\n{% block footer_org_name %}\nUniversit\u00e0 della Calabria\n{% endblock footer_org_name %}\n\n\n{% block footer_org_subname %}\nIl Campus per eccellenza\n{% endblock footer_org_subname %}\n```\n\nEsempio di pagine figlie (qui index.html)\n-----------------------------------------\n\n```\n{% extends 'base-setup.html' %}\n\n{% load static %}\n\n{% block container %}\n\n
\n \n
\n
\n
\n \"imagealt\"\n
\n
\n
\n \n
\n
\n
\n
\n Category\n

Heading lorem ipsum dolor sit amet, consetetur sadipscing.

\n

Platea dictumst vestibulum rhoncus est pellentesque elit ullamcorper dignissim cras. Dictum sit amet justo donec enim diam vulputate ut. Eu nisl nunc mi ipsum faucibus.

\n \n
\n
\n
\n
\n
\n\n\n\n
\n

Lorem Ipsum

\n

Ab illo tempore, ab est sed immemorabili.
\n Ullamco laboris nisi ut aliquid ex ea commodi consequat.
\n Quis aute iure reprehenderit in voluptate velit esse.
\n Petierunt uti sibi concilium totius Galliae in diem certam indicere.

\n

Pellentesque habitant morbi tristique senectus et netus.

\n\n \n\n
\n\n\n{% endblock container %}\n\n{% block bottom_scripts %}\n\n\n\n
\n
\n \n \n Esempio di template vuoto\n
\n

\n Torna alla pagina principale degli esempi\n

\n \n
\n\n\n{% endblock bottom_scripts %}\n\n```",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/francesco-filicetti/django-unical-agid-template", "keywords": "", "license": "BSD License", "maintainer": "", "maintainer_email": "", "name": "django-unical-agid-template", "package_url": "https://pypi.org/project/django-unical-agid-template/", "platform": "", "project_url": "https://pypi.org/project/django-unical-agid-template/", "project_urls": { "Homepage": "https://github.com/francesco-filicetti/django-unical-agid-template" }, "release_url": "https://pypi.org/project/django-unical-agid-template/0.1/", "requires_dist": null, "requires_python": "", "summary": "Template Django conforme a linee guida AGID per l'Universita' della Calabria", "version": "0.1" }, "last_serial": 4870135,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"49ce34e76a533b8ce45d402d4307c051", "sha256": "e5d708e69685f55957f900a8e32062ea27dca3132f026cd7103211bbe8b50d1c" }, "downloads": -1, "filename": "django-unical-agid-template-00.1.tar.gz", "has_sig": false, "md5_digest": "49ce34e76a533b8ce45d402d4307c051",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 518597, "upload_time": "2019-02-26T15:15:21", "url": "https://files.pythonhosted.org/packages/85/dc/6ebce8ecc7655ac637f6c8c530bd581ff7e6bfee778100a4bc3c1550c664/django-unical-agid-template-00.1.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"49ce34e76a533b8ce45d402d4307c051", "sha256": "e5d708e69685f55957f900a8e32062ea27dca3132f026cd7103211bbe8b50d1c" }, "downloads": -1, "filename": "django-unical-agid-template-00.1.tar.gz", "has_sig": false, "md5_digest": "49ce34e76a533b8ce45d402d4307c051",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 518597, "upload_time": "2019-02-26T15:15:21", "url": "https://files.pythonhosted.org/packages/85/dc/6ebce8ecc7655ac637f6c8c530bd581ff7e6bfee778100a4bc3c1550c664/django-unical-agid-template-00.1.tar.gz" } ] }